Output 53a8f56a08ef514afb17f60f901b4964040692ad852691b24d9236f34657b158:1

value
67882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fc21d9a5b36343f1714d1f8d51b0c6113376008 OP_EQUAL
address
3Eo96NCktFQbMakuZeGhD5mTPmajFZpNvy
transaction
53a8f56a08ef514afb17f60f901b4964040692ad852691b24d9236f34657b158
spent
true